charliauthor 's review for:
Our Stop
by Laura Jane Williams
Love love LOVED!
I've usually got my head stuck in a Fantasy books so it was really refreshing after a few heavy books, to have something fun and light to get stuck into and smile at!
In short, a guy fancies a girl on a train and sends an ad/message to her in the Lonely Hearts kind of column in the paper. What follows is a series of near misses (some more believable than others imo) in which you are stuck on the will-they-or-wont-they rollercoaster which was soooo much fun!
What i really enjoyed with this other than the cuteness overload is that the male MC Daniel was a really likeable and sweet-without-being-a-dullard Nice Guy. I was rooting for him the whole time, more so than the female MC Nadia, who while wasnt a real problem in any way, was just a bit toooo clumsy and woe-is-me for me. Nothing terrible by any means, i just wanted her to be a touch less sappy but thats just me.
Other than that, it was such a cute read, set in the well to do world of young-ish Londoners who have cool friends and do cool events and can actual afford to live here LOL
I really liked it and the only reason i dont give it 5 is because i wanted an all the trimmings HEA! I wanted the wedding, the kids, the grandkids even to wrap it up all nicely in a bow! :D
